THIS SUBSTANTIAL OVERVIEW ACTS AS YOUR SECRET TO OPENING THE MYSTERIES OF WEB SOLUTIONS AND BECOMING A MASTER IN THE FIELD

This Substantial Overview Acts As Your Secret To Opening The Mysteries Of Web Solutions And Becoming A Master In The Field

This Substantial Overview Acts As Your Secret To Opening The Mysteries Of Web Solutions And Becoming A Master In The Field

Blog Article

Material Author-Cotton Fry

Discover the utmost Internet Solutions Handbook for all your needs. Explore communication methods, core concepts of SOAP and REST, and finest techniques for smooth implementation. Discover the keys to mastering internet services, from understanding the essentials to implementing scalable architecture. Master the art of developing protected systems and enhancing for future growth. web design company of internet services at your fingertips.

Introduction of Internet Services



If you have actually ever wondered what web solutions are and exactly how they work, this introduction is the excellent location to start. Internet solutions are a way for various applications to connect with each other over the internet. They permit smooth assimilation of systems, making it easier to share data and functionalities.

Among the essential facets of web solutions is their use of conventional procedures like HTTP and XML to assist in interaction. This standardization makes sure that various systems can recognize and interact with each other efficiently. Internet solutions can be classified into two primary kinds: SOAP (Simple Object Accessibility Procedure) and REST (Representational State Transfer).

SOAP is a procedure that uses XML for message exchange, while remainder relies on conventional HTTP methods like obtain, PUBLISH, PUT, and remove. Both have their strengths and are used in different situations based upon requirements.

Secret Principles and Technologies



Discovering the foundational ideas and innovations of internet services is essential for comprehending their capability and application in contemporary systems. When delving right into the key ideas and technologies of web solutions, you unlock to a globe of interconnected possibilities. Right here are some essential elements to comprehend:

- ** SOAP (Simple Things Accessibility Protocol) **: This procedure defines the framework of messages exchanged between web solutions.
- ** WSDL (Internet Solutions Description Language) **: WSDL is utilized to define the capabilities used by a web service.
- ** REST (Representational State Transfer) **: A building style that uses standard HTTP approaches for interaction between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ays an important role in data exchange between internet solutions as a result of its adaptability and readability.

Recognizing these core ideas and technologies will certainly lay a solid structure for your journey right into the realm of internet solutions.

Best Practices for Execution



To ensure successful execution of internet services, focus on adherence to finest methods. Begin by extensively recording your web solution APIs, including clear descriptions of endpoints, criteria, and anticipated actions. Consistent calling conventions and versioning of APIs are critical for maintainability. When creating your internet services, comply with the concepts of REST to create a scalable and versatile architecture. Carry out appropriate verification and permission mechanisms to safeguard your solutions, such as OAuth or API keys.

Testing is vital in making certain the integrity of your web services. Develop thorough test cases that cover different situations, including positive and unfavorable testing. Continual combination and automated screening can help catch concerns early in the advancement procedure. Display your web solutions in real-time to identify performance bottlenecks and possible failings. Logging and mistake handling are essential for detecting issues and fixing problems successfully.


Finally, consider the scalability of your web services deliberately for future growth. Implement caching systems and load balancing to manage boosted website traffic. Frequently review and enhance your code for effectiveness. By adhering to these ideal practices, you can enhance the application of web solutions and guarantee their success.

Final thought

Congratulations! You have actually simply unlocked the secret to mastering internet solutions. By recognizing the crucial principles and modern technologies, and applying ideal methods, you're well on your method to coming to be a web services expert.

Maintain discovering and trying out what you've learned to proceed increasing your understanding and skills in this interesting field.

The globe of web services is currently at your fingertips, ready for you to check out and overcome. Take https://www.mckinsey.com/industries/financial-services/our-insights/how-asian-insurers-can-use-digital-marketing-to-fuel-growth in the trip!